Planning Your DIY Wooden TV Stand

Before you start swinging a hammer, proper planning is essential. This is where you decide the size, style, and features of your DIY wooden TV stand. First, measure your TV. This might sound obvious, but you need to know the exact width and depth to ensure your TV will fit comfortably on the stand. Add a few inches on each side for a buffer and consider the depth needed to accommodate any soundbars or gaming consoles you might have. Next, think about your storage needs. Do you need shelves for a DVD player, game consoles, or cable boxes? Drawers for remotes and other accessories? Make a list of everything you want to store and factor that into your design. Sketching out your design is super helpful. It doesn't have to be a masterpiece, but a basic drawing will give you a clear visual of what you're building. Include dimensions, shelf placements, and any other details that are important to you. This will serve as your blueprint throughout the build. Research different styles to get some inspiration. Look at online images of TV stands and take note of the features you like. Consider the overall style of your living room and choose a design that complements it. This could be anything from a sleek, modern stand to a more traditional, rustic piece. Then, it's time to choose your materials. Wood selection is crucial. The type of wood you choose will affect the appearance, durability, and cost of your stand. Common choices include pine (affordable and easy to work with), oak (strong and durable), and plywood (versatile and cost-effective). Consider the weight of your TV and the items you plan to store when selecting your wood. Once you've chosen your wood, you'll need to calculate the amount you need. This involves taking precise measurements from your design and calculating the total square footage of wood required. Don’t forget to add a little extra for any mistakes! Finally, make a list of all the tools and materials you'll need. This includes wood, screws, nails, a saw, a drill, sandpaper, a level, and a finish of your choice (stain, paint, or varnish). Determining the Perfect Size and Style

Alright, let’s get down to brass tacks: figuring out the perfect size and style for your simple wood TV stand. It's not just about aesthetics; functionality is key. First things first, measure your TV. Seriously, get that tape measure out! Note the width, depth, and height. Next, add a buffer to the width. I recommend at least a few inches on each side. This buffer not only ensures your TV fits but also provides a bit of breathing room and visual balance. The depth of the stand needs to accommodate your TV’s base, soundbars, and any other accessories. Don't forget to measure these items as well. Now, think about the height. Consider your viewing angle. You want the center of your TV to be at eye level when you're seated. Use a chair or couch to simulate your viewing position and measure from the floor to your eye level. Subtract the height of your TV, and that will give you a rough idea of how tall your TV stand should be. Next up, storage! Do you need shelves, drawers, or both? Shelves are great for media players, game consoles, and decorative items. Drawers are perfect for remotes, cables, and other small accessories. Sketching out your design is super helpful. This is your chance to visualize the stand. Draw a basic outline, including all the dimensions, shelf placements, and any special features you want. This sketch will be your guide throughout the build. When it comes to style, do some research. Look at magazines, websites like Pinterest and Instagram, and other sources to get inspired. Consider the overall style of your living room. Do you want a modern, minimalist look with clean lines, or a rustic, farmhouse vibe with a distressed finish? Consider the wood type. Pine is a budget-friendly option that's easy to work with and looks great painted or stained. Oak is a stronger, more durable option that gives a classic look. Plywood is super versatile and can be used for a variety of styles. Think about the finish. Will you paint it, stain it, or leave the wood natural? Paint is great for adding color and personality. Staining enhances the natural grain of the wood, and a clear coat protects the wood while showing it off. Selecting the Right Materials

Choosing the right materials is the cornerstone of any successful simple wood TV stand project. You want materials that are durable, visually appealing, and fit your budget. So, let’s break it down, shall we? The most crucial decision is the type of wood. Pine is a popular choice for beginners because it's affordable and easy to work with. It's a softwood, which means it’s relatively easy to cut, drill, and assemble. However, pine is also softer than hardwoods, so it can be more prone to dents and scratches. Oak is a hardwood, known for its strength and durability. It's a great choice if you want a stand that will last for years. Oak has a beautiful grain that can be enhanced with stain, and it’s resistant to wear and tear. Plywood is another versatile option. It’s made by gluing thin layers of wood together, making it strong and stable. Plywood is also less prone to warping than solid wood, making it ideal for larger pieces like shelves and tabletops. Now, consider the thickness of the wood. For the main frame and legs, you’ll want a thicker wood, like 1x4s or 2x4s, to provide stability. For shelves, you can use thinner plywood or solid wood, depending on the weight you plan to put on them. Don't forget about hardware! Screws and nails are essential for assembling the stand. Choose screws that are the correct length for your wood thickness to avoid piercing through the wood. Wood glue can add extra strength to the joints. For the finish, you have several options. Stain enhances the natural grain of the wood, adding depth and richness. Paint is a great way to add color and personality. Varnish or polyurethane will protect the wood from scratches and wear, providing a durable, clear finish. Estimate the amount of wood you'll need. Calculate the total square footage by measuring each piece from your design. It's always a good idea to buy a little extra to account for any mistakes or cuts. Check that the wood is straight and free from knots or defects. A straight piece will ensure your stand is level and stable. Also, inspect the wood for any damage before purchasing. Step-by-Step Guide to Building Your DIY TV Stand

Alright, it's time to roll up our sleeves and get building! This step-by-step guide will walk you through the process of building your DIY simple wood TV stand, from cutting the wood to applying the final finish. Let’s get started, shall we? First things first: Gather all your tools and materials. Make sure you have everything you need, including the wood, screws, nails, saw, drill, sandpaper, level, and finish of your choice. A well-organized workspace is your best friend. Clear a flat surface and arrange your tools and materials so they are easy to reach. Safety first! Wear safety glasses to protect your eyes from wood chips and dust. Use ear protection if you're working with power tools, and wear a dust mask to avoid inhaling sawdust. Then, start cutting the wood. Use a saw to cut the wood pieces according to your design dimensions. Always measure twice and cut once. Make sure your cuts are straight and accurate. Sanding is next. Sand all the wood pieces, using sandpaper of varying grits to smooth out any rough edges and splinters. Start with a coarser grit and work your way up to a finer grit for a smooth finish. Assemble the frame. Use screws and wood glue to join the frame pieces together. Make sure the corners are square and the frame is level. If you're using legs, attach them to the frame now. Add the shelves. Cut the shelves to the correct size and attach them to the frame using screws or shelf supports. Make sure the shelves are level and evenly spaced. If you're adding drawers, assemble the drawer boxes and attach the drawer slides to the frame and the drawers. Install the drawer fronts. Apply the finish. This is where you bring your stand to life. Apply your chosen finish – stain, paint, or varnish – according to the manufacturer's instructions. Let the finish dry completely before moving on. Last but not least: Add any hardware, such as handles or knobs for the drawers. Place your TV and accessories on the stand. Step back and admire your handiwork! Cutting the Wood and Assembling the Frame

Alright, it's time to get our hands dirty and start building the frame of your DIY simple wood TV stand. This is the foundation, so getting it right is crucial. First, gather all your wood and tools. Make sure you have your saw, measuring tape, pencil, and safety gear ready. Start by carefully measuring and marking each piece of wood according to your design. Double-check your measurements to avoid costly mistakes. Then, begin cutting the wood. Using a saw, cut each piece of wood precisely along the marked lines. Always measure twice and cut once to ensure accuracy. If you're using a circular saw or miter saw, make sure the blade is sharp and the wood is securely clamped. For the frame, you’ll typically need pieces for the top, bottom, and sides. Cut these pieces to the correct length, ensuring that they will form a sturdy rectangular structure. After cutting the frame pieces, it's time to assemble them. Apply wood glue to the joints for added strength. Use screws to secure the pieces together, making sure the corners are square. A framing square can be your best friend here. If you're using legs, attach them to the frame. Legs can be simple wooden blocks, or you can get creative and use metal legs for a more modern look. Make sure the legs are securely attached to the frame. Once the frame is assembled and the legs are attached, let the glue dry completely before moving on to the next step. This is a great time to check the frame for squareness and levelness. Use a level to ensure everything is straight and stable. Adding Shelves, Drawers, and Finishing Touches

Now, let's get into the details: adding shelves, drawers, and those all-important finishing touches to your DIY simple wood TV stand. First, measure and cut the shelves. Determine the size of the shelves based on your design. Cut the shelf pieces to the correct dimensions using a saw. If you're using plywood, make sure the edges are clean and smooth. Install the shelves. Decide where you want your shelves placed within the frame. Use shelf supports, cleats, or screws to attach the shelves to the frame. Ensure the shelves are level and evenly spaced. This is your chance to add storage options! Now, let’s talk drawers. If your design includes drawers, assemble the drawer boxes. Cut the drawer sides, front, back, and bottom. Assemble the drawer boxes using screws and wood glue for added strength. Next, install the drawer slides. Attach the drawer slides to the inside of the frame and to the drawer boxes. This is essential for smooth drawer operation. Then, attach the drawer fronts. Secure the drawer fronts to the drawer boxes, making sure they are aligned properly. Add handles or knobs. Choose handles or knobs that match your style. Attach them to the drawer fronts using screws. Next, sand the entire stand. Lightly sand the entire TV stand, including the frame, shelves, and drawers. This will smooth out any imperfections and prepare the surface for the finish. You've got options for finishes! Apply your chosen finish – stain, paint, or varnish – according to the manufacturer's instructions. If you're staining, apply the stain evenly and wipe off the excess. If you're painting, apply multiple thin coats for a smooth finish. Varnish or polyurethane will protect the wood from scratches and wear. Finally, let the finish dry completely.
